    Sharron Armel has created a technique class titled " New Tricks."  She describes it as an easy way to make Card Trick blocks.  She says it is easy because: 

    • Some of the fabric can be precut to 2 1/2" strips
    • No marking is required
    • Very few bias seams
    • There is a little room for error

    I'm always open for a new, improved way to make a block and this method sounds like a big improvement!

    This Class will explore different ways of constructing flying geese.  It will help you identify which method you enjoy and which methods yields accurate units.  Materials and patterns will be provided for blocks to use in a community quilt.  This class is for guild members of any skill level.  The class supply list can be found at Methods Class Flying Geese.docx

    Camp Bluebird is a retreat for cancer survivors held at the Bonclarken Conference Centre in Flat Rock where the guild offers 2 afternoon crafting sessions to the retreaters from 1:00 pm to 4:30 pm. The guild provides everything that the retreaters need to make a small project that they can take home. We need 8 volunteers each afternoon to provide encouragement and support to the retreaters. Several previous volunteers have reported back how enriching and rewarding this event was for them. It is also a great way to connect with other members of the guild.     We welcome Candy Grisham back from Missouri!  Her program for us this month is about our "Tools of the Trade" for quilting and sewing. Have you ever needed something on a Sunday and your quilt store wasn't open?  Did you know that some of the tools we use are available at Big Box stores near you that are open 7 days a week?  Candy will tell us about what she has found out there and where it is.  This information could certainly come in handy and could even save us some money!
